Confirm E-Verify enrollment before accepting offers

STEM OPT's 24-month extension requires your employer to be enrolled in E-Verify. Ask your UNH hiring contact or HR representative to confirm active E-Verify participation before signing your offer letter, so your extension eligibility isn't at risk after you start.

Align your degree field with your target role

OPT authorizes work directly related to your degree program. At UNH, roles in education technology, institutional research, and data analytics require you to demonstrate a clear connection between your field of study and the position, so prepare a brief explanation for your hiring manager.

Time your application around OPT start dates

USCIS requires you to apply for OPT up to 90 days before your program end date, and your EAD must be active before your first day of work. Coordinate your UNH start date with your DSO early so your EAD arrival timeline and your onboarding date align without a gap.

Research prevailing wages before salary negotiations

Use the OFLC Wage Search to look up prevailing wages for your target role in New Hampshire before negotiating your offer. Education sector salaries vary significantly by job zone, and knowing the DOL wage level for your occupation strengthens your position and supports any future H-1B transition.

University of New Hampshire OPT Eligibility: Frequently Asked Questions

Does University of New Hampshire sponsor OPT visas?

UNH doesn't sponsor OPT directly since OPT is work authorization USCIS grants to you as an F-1 student, not a petition filed by the employer. What UNH does is hire students who already hold an OPT EAD. UNH is also enrolled in E-Verify, which means STEM OPT students can qualify for the 24-month extension while employed there.

Which departments at University of New Hampshire typically hire OPT students?

OPT hiring at UNH tends to concentrate in research-intensive departments, including STEM research centers, institutional research, information technology, and academic program administration. Graduate programs with active federal or private grant funding are especially likely to bring on OPT students in coordinator or analyst roles, since those positions align closely with degree requirements.

How do I approach the OPT hiring process at University of New Hampshire?

Apply through UNH's standard job portal and indicate your OPT status and EAD validity dates in your application or early in the interview process. Bring your EAD, I-20, and a letter from your DSO confirming your OPT authorization to any offer discussion. HR will complete an I-9 verification using E-Verify once you're hired.

What is the timeline for starting work at University of New Hampshire on OPT?

Your OPT EAD must be in hand before your first day of work at UNH. USCIS typically takes two to three months to process an OPT EAD application, so file with your DSO up to 90 days before your program end date. Build at least a two-week buffer between your expected EAD arrival and your agreed start date to account for mail delays.
